Summary
Everything fell apart the moment he said it.
“I’m getting married.”
And not to her.
Four years of dating, only to find out she was just a chapter—never the ending. Worse, he had the audacity to suggest she stay on as his mistress, like her love was something he could keep tucked away in secret.
Doeun walked away without looking back.
Heartbroken and exhausted, she flew to Hawaii for work, hoping the ocean breeze might help her forget. That’s where she met him—Ian. Mysterious, magnetic, and completely different from anyone she’d ever known. Under the sun and stars, they shared electric moments… but never their truths.
“Mo… Ana. My name is Moana,” she told him, borrowing the name from a movie just to keep her distance.
One rule. No real names. No real attachments.
It was supposed to be a one-time escape—until he found her again.
“It’s been a while, Moana,” he said, his voice low and steady. “Or should I call you… Eun Doeun?”
